Labour leader Ivana Bacik talks to Hugh Linehan and Pat Leahy about her efforts to revive the party’s fortunes since taking over early last year.

In a political landscape where most parties are promising similar things to voters, how can Labour cut through?

And how much of Sinn Féin’s agenda would Labour be willing to support if a coalition agreement were on the cards after the next election?
